Galatasaray Set to Offload Moroccan Midfielder Younès Belhanda in Summer Transfer Window

The Moroccan international Younès Belhanda should leave the ranks of his club, "Galatasaray", during the summer transfer window, his coach having pushed him towards the exit. He has been placed on the list of outgoing players by the club’s management, after spending two seasons with the Süper Lig champion.
Belhanda, who has just had a bad experience at the Africa Cup of Nations (CAN) with the "Atlas Lions", will have to turn to the many proposals from Gulf clubs, particularly the Saudi Arabian championship. During the winter transfer window, the player had received offers from Saudi clubs, all of which were rejected by the Galatasaray coach, despite the agreement of the club’s management. A return to the French championship is also not to be ruled out.
In order to prepare the club for the European Champions League, the Turkish team’s coach, Fatih Terim, has decided to inject new blood, by recruiting the Colombian Radamel Falcao, the Spaniard Diego Costa and a Belgian international, while dispensing with the services of four players, including the midfielder of the "Atlas Lions".
Born in Avignon in 1990, Younès Belhanda is a Moroccan-born international footballer. He started in the ranks of the French club Montpellier, before joining Dynamo Kiev in 2013 and Schalke 04 for a season. In 2016, he joined Galatasaray.
